Brokers

A broker is a commission-taking intermediary on the sales side — a rep or agency that brings you business and takes a percentage. Brokers are optional; many organizations never use them.

A broker can be attached to a customer, which sets a default broker and fee, and the broker and its fee then flow onto that customer's sales orders, where the commission is calculated.

Key fields

FieldMeaning
nameBroker name
sortOrderManual ordering for pick lists
isActiveWhether the broker is available for new links

Relationships

  • Linked from customers (with a default fee percentage).
  • Recorded on sales orders, where the commission is computed.

A broker that's in use on customers or sales orders can't be deleted; deactivate it instead.
